Adani Green Energy on Friday introduced the start of the operation of its 775 megawatt solar energy initiatives in Khavda, Gujarat. The capacities have been operationalised after securing related clearances, Adani Green Energy Ltd (AGEL) stated in an alternate submitting.
Adani Green Energy via its numerous wholly-owned stepdown subsidiaries has operationalised an mixture 775 MW solar energy initiatives at Khavda, Gujarat, it stated. “Based on the relevant clearances, it was decided at 00:12 am on March 29, 2024 to operationalize the plant and commence power generation from March 29, 2024,” the corporate stated.
